Revolutionizing Food Preservation: The Growing Demand For Freeze-Drying Equipment

The freeze-drying equipment market is experiencing exponential growth as more and more industries discover the benefits of this innovative technology. Freeze drying, also known as lyophilization, is a process that removes moisture from products through sublimation, turning them into a dried form without compromising their taste, texture, or nutritional value. This method of preservation has been used for decades in the food industry to extend the shelf life of products such as fruits, vegetables, meats, and dairy items. However, advancements in technology and increased awareness of the benefits of freeze-dried products have led to a surge in demand for freeze-drying equipment across various sectors.

One of the key drivers of the freeze-drying equipment market is the growing demand for convenience foods. Freeze-dried products are lightweight, easy to store, and have a longer shelf life compared to fresh produce, making them an ideal choice for consumers looking for quick and easy meal options. In addition, freeze-dried foods retain their original flavor, color, and nutritional content, making them a healthier alternative to traditional packaged foods that are often laden with preservatives and artificial ingredients. As a result, food manufacturers are increasingly turning to freeze-drying equipment to meet the rising demand for convenient and nutritious food products.

Another major factor contributing to the growth of the freeze-drying equipment market is the increasing adoption of freeze-drying technology in the pharmaceutical industry. Freeze-drying is a widely used method for preserving pharmaceutical products such as vaccines, antibiotics, and biologics, as it helps extend their shelf life and maintain their potency. With the rising demand for specialized medicines and biopharmaceuticals, the need for reliable and efficient freeze-drying equipment has never been greater. Pharmaceutical companies are investing heavily in advanced freeze-drying systems to ensure the quality and efficacy of their products, driving the growth of the freeze-drying equipment market.

Moreover, the rise of the nutraceutical industry has also contributed to the expansion of the freeze-drying equipment market. Nutraceuticals are products derived from food sources that provide health benefits beyond their basic nutritional value. Freeze-drying is an ideal method for preserving the bioactive compounds found in fruits, herbs, and other natural ingredients used in nutraceutical products, ensuring they retain their efficacy and potency. As consumers become more health-conscious and seek out natural remedies and supplements to support their well-being, the demand for freeze-drying equipment in the nutraceutical sector continues to increase.

In addition to the food, pharmaceutical, and nutraceutical industries, freeze-drying equipment is also finding applications in the cosmetics and skincare sectors. Freeze-drying technology is being used to preserve the active ingredients in beauty products, such as serums, masks, and creams, enhancing their stability and effectiveness. With the growing demand for natural and organic skincare products, freeze-dried ingredients are becoming increasingly popular among consumers seeking safe and sustainable alternatives. As a result, manufacturers in the cosmetics industry are investing in freeze-drying equipment to meet the growing demand for high-quality and innovative skincare products.
